What to pack for Midtfyns Festival 2026 (and what to leave at home)
A packing checklist for Midtfyns Festival 2026 in Ringe: day-bag essentials, camping kit, the official banned list, and how Event Lockers and a Volt-Charger let you carry less.
Midtfyns Festival 2026 runs Friday 4 and Saturday 5 September at Dyrskuepladsen in Ringe, with a free warm-up evening on Thursday 3 September (official site). There is a campsite too, so how you pack depends on whether you are in for one long day or the whole weekend.
Here is a checklist tuned to this exact festival: what belongs in the day bag, what campers should add, what security will turn away at the gate, and how to carry almost nothing at all. For the full rundown of the festival itself, see our Midtfyns Festival guide.
One festival, two packing lists
Midtfyns is a compact festival on the edge of Ringe on Funen. The site sits at Lombjergevej 20, a short walk from the parking on Boltinggårdvej, and the town is well connected by public transport (official practical info). If you booked camping, the campsite for 2026 is just across the stream from the grounds, and you check in for both festival and camping at the campsite. The layout can shift from year to year, so give the info page a look before you set off.
Early September on Funen usually means mild days, cool evenings and a real chance of rain. Pack for all three.
The day bag: keep it light
- Bank card. Midtfyns is a cashless festival. Bars and food stalls take card, MobilePay is not accepted, and cash can be exchanged for a festival payment card at the ticket booth (payment info).
- Phone, fully charged. It is your ticket wallet, your payment backup and your "where are you standing" tool. A powerbank helps if you own one, and there is a smarter option below.
- Rain jacket, not an umbrella. Umbrellas and parasols are on the festival's banned list, so a packable rain jacket is the move.
- A warm layer. Friday and Saturday run late into the night, and September nights on Funen get cold fast.
- Photo ID. Alcohol is only served to over-18s and ID gets checked (official info).
- Earplugs and sunscreen. Tiny, cheap, and both earn their place by Saturday afternoon.
Camping kit: the weekend upgrade
Camping at Midtfyns means two nights, not a week, so keep it simple: a tent, a sleeping bag that can handle single-digit nights, a sleeping mat, a headlamp and more dry socks than feels reasonable.
One thing to know before you load the car: tents, pop-up tents and pavilions are banned inside the festival grounds themselves, so all of this stays at the campsite (banned items list). Check the same page for the current camping rules before you go.
Leave these at home
The festival publishes a clear list of what does not get past the entrance (official info page). The short version:
- Your own drinks, alcoholic or not
- Umbrellas and parasols
- Grills, hard plastic cool boxes and ice packs
- Tents and pavilions (inside the festival grounds)
- Banners and fireworks
- Professional camera and video equipment
- Pets
When in doubt, leave it. Anything security stops at the gate becomes your problem to solve, not theirs.
